The Importance of Supporting Small Manufacturers


In today's fast-paced economy, where large corporations often dominate the marketplace, the significance of small manufacturers has become increasingly pronounced. Small manufacturers, typically defined as those with fewer than 500 employees, play a crucial role in innovation, job creation, and preserving local economies. Supporting these enterprises is not just beneficial for the owners; it has far-reaching effects on communities, economies, and even the environment.

Moreover, small manufacturers are fundamental to job creation. According to the Small Business Administration, small businesses, including manufacturers, account for a substantial portion of job creation in the United States. By supporting these companies, we are not only preserving existing jobs but also fostering an environment where new opportunities can arise. Small manufacturers often hire locally, which means that when you buy from them, you are contributing to the livelihoods of your neighbors. This local employment helps reduce unemployment rates and supports community development.

The impact of small manufacturers extends beyond the economy and employment; it also encompasses sustainable practices. Many small manufacturers are more inclined to adopt environmentally friendly practices compared to their larger counterparts. They often utilize local materials, which reduces transportation emissions and supports local suppliers. Additionally, small manufacturers are more likely to implement sustainable production processes out of necessity and a desire to build a responsible brand image. By choosing to support these businesses, consumers can contribute to a more sustainable economy.


Furthermore, small manufacturers enrich local communities by adding character and diversity to the marketplace. They often take part in community events, sponsor local activities, and invest in social initiatives. This engagement fosters a sense of community and strengthens social ties, making neighborhoods more vibrant and dynamic.
